2008 suzuki boulevard gears change good going up but not so good coming down

1. Is it a new bike for you? or do you own it for a while? 2. try checking the clutch. it might need tightning. try from the lever on the top. if you don't know how to, then ask a mechanic. 3. check if you need to "rev it up". when lowering a gear, you let go of the throttle, pull the clutch, give a quick twist of the throttle (pull and let go) while lowering a gear to match the rev's of the engine to the gear, and ease of the clutch off. 4. check you oil level. Some bikes are very sensitive to low oil. My v strom when hitting half, will start acting out with the gear.

I have a roaring noise from the front wheel of a

Hello James, when the wheel bearing goes it is usually evident through the handlebars. A rumbling, gritty kind of feeling. If you feel any kind of resistance it could also be the front caliper sticking. Support your bike with the front wheel off the ground so you can turn it by hand. This will help to troubleshoot better. I hope this helps.

Need to take off fuel

It isn't difficult, especially if you can get some one to hold the tank up for you. Sorry I don't have pictures.

1. remove the seat: on a stock seat there is one bolt behind the pillion, slide the pillion seat backwards out of the leather handle and undo the two bolts underneath to release the driver's seat which also slides out backwards.

2. disconnect the battery: always a good idea when working on your bike, not always necessary but generally safer.

3. remove the instruments: the instrument cluster on top of the tank is held on by three allen bolts, the front two are much easier to get to with a multi-tip-screwdriver type tool. Underneath the panel is an electrical connector in a rubber sheath. just peel the rubber back and gently work the connector loose - don't pull on the wires.

2. unbolt the tank: at the back of the tank you'll see one large bolt, undo that and slide the tank back until it is free of the rubber mounts towards the front of the bike.

3. get help: now you could do with someone to hold the tank up while you work underneath it. it is possible to do this by yourself but much, much more annoying.

4. disconnect the electrics: there are two connections to unfasten before lifting the tank. the electrical connector is most likely brown in color and connects two sets of wires, you should be able to depress the clips with your fingers and separate the wires easily. again, don't pull on the wires themselves.

5. disconnect the fuel pump: the pump is part of the tank and is connected to the injection system by a pipe with a clip on the end. this one is a bit fiddly but you should be able to depress the inner section of the clip and work the pipe free of the tank with your fingers. You may find that a little fuel spills out but it won't be very much.
